Earlier this week, Rackspace Technology cut its 2026 revenue guidance to US$2.45–2.55 billion, reduced expected adjusted EBITDA, and outlined exits from low-margin public cloud resale and legacy hosting while launching a US$250 million at-the-market equity program to fund an enterprise AI push. Palantir Technologies (NasdaqGS:PLTR) announced a multi-year, multimillion-dollar expansion with GNP Seguros, Mexico’s largest insurer. The deal marks Palantir’s first publicly disclosed commercial customer in Latin America across multiple insurance lines. Palantir also finalized an operating model with Rackspace to deploy its AI platforms in regulated and sovereign environments. Palantir Technologies signed a multi-year, multimillion-dollar expansion deal with GNP Seguros, Mexico’s largest insurer, marking its first publicly announced commercial customer in Latin America and expanding use of its Foundry and AI platform across health, life, auto, and property insurance lines.
